Join our team as a Nuclear Medicine Technologist, where you will be responsible for performing a wide range of Nuclear Medicine examinations on patients of all ages. This includes utilizing advanced imaging equipment such as SPECT-CT, Gamma Cameras, Thyroid Probe, and PET-CT with Diagnostic CT, and, when applicable, PET-MR systems. Your role will encompass organ imaging, function studies, computer analysis and assisting physicians in the therapeutic administration of radioisotopes under prescribed conditions.

Your expertise will contribute to the comprehensive care of our patients and advance our diagnostic and therapeutic capabilities in nuclear medicine. Our Nuclear Medicine department includes the following: PET/CT (Biograph 600), SPECT/CT (Symbia Intevo Bold) cardiac stress testing, and radioimmunotherapy suite. As

a successful candidate, you will:
  • Rotate between General Nuclear Medicine, Theranostics and PET/CT.
  • Perform radionuclide procedures on patients of all ages, inclusive of organ imaging, function studies, computer analysis and assisting the physician in the therapeutic administration of radioisotopes under prescribed conditions.
  • Be responsible for equipment calibration checks/field uniformity, and reporting/scheduling equipment maintenance, as necessary.
  • Utilize protective shielding and prescribed safety standards for radioactive sources in accordance with prescribed safety standards.
  • May include weekends and on-call scheduling
Qualifications

Your qualifications should include:

  • Graduation from an accredited Nuclear Medicine Program
  • New Graduates accepted
  • California State Certification in Nuclear Medicine AND Certified Nuclear Medicine Technologist Certification (CNMT) or R.T. (N) (ARRT)
  • BLS (AHA)
  • With 3 years of experiences as a Nuc Med Tech, candidates may be considered for Molecular Imaging Technologist II (Pay Range for MIT II: $51.23/hr - $66.60/hr - $81.98/hr)
